Module: Gzr::Connection

Included in:
Gzr::Commands::Connection::Dialects, Gzr::Commands::Connection::Ls
Defined in:
lib/gzr/modules/connection.rb

Instance Method Summary collapse

Instance Method Details

#query_all_connections(fields = nil) ⇒ Object



27
28
29
30
31
32
33
34
35
36
37
# File 'lib/gzr/modules/connection.rb', line 27

def query_all_connections(fields=nil)
  data = nil
  begin
    data = @sdk.all_connections(fields ? {:fields=>fields} : nil )
  rescue LookerSDK::Error => e
      say_error "Error querying all_connections({:fields=>\"#{fields}\"})"
      say_error e.message
      raise
  end
  data
end

#query_all_dialects(fields = nil) ⇒ Object



39
40
41
42
43
44
45
46
47
48
49
# File 'lib/gzr/modules/connection.rb', line 39

def query_all_dialects(fields=nil)
  data = nil
  begin
    data = @sdk.all_dialect_infos(fields ? {:fields=>fields} : nil )
  rescue LookerSDK::Error => e
      say_error "Error querying all_dialect_infos({:fields=>\"#{fields}\"})"
      say_error e.message
      raise
  end
  data
end